A nuclear stress test, also known as a myocardial perfusion scan, is a diagnostic imaging procedure that assesses blood flow to the heart muscle. The test combines physical exertion or pharmaceutical stimulation with the injection of a small amount of a radioactive tracer. This tracer is captured by a specialized camera to create images of the heart at rest and under stress. Understanding the total cost is complicated, as the final price can vary widely depending on numerous factors.
The Components That Determine the Cost
The total charge for a nuclear stress test is a composite of several distinct billable services. These charges are typically separated into professional fees, facility fees, and the cost of specialized supplies. The professional fee covers the services of the cardiologist and the nuclear medicine physician who oversee the procedure and interpret the final image results.
The most significant portion of the cost often stems from the facility fee. This fee covers the use of the specialized imaging equipment, such as the Single-Photon Emission Computed Tomography (SPECT) scanner, and the time of the nuclear medicine technologists. This fee also includes the overhead of the clinic or hospital setting.
The supplies component involves the cost of the radiopharmaceutical tracer, such as Technetium-99m, which is injected into the bloodstream, and the stress agent if a pharmacological test is necessary. The chemical stimulants, like Lexiscan or Dobutamine, require careful handling and are a substantial expense for the provider.
Typical Price Ranges for Nuclear Stress Tests
The sticker price for a nuclear stress test before any insurance negotiation can be highly variable. Gross charges for the procedure frequently range from approximately \\(600 to over \\)5,000, depending on the provider and location. This dramatic range reflects the lack of pricing standardization across the healthcare industry.
Data from negotiated payer-specific prices show that the median cost of a nuclear stress test can vary by thousands of dollars even within the same hospital system. For example, some commercial insurers may negotiate a price as low as \\(460, while another insurer is charged over \\)3,200. These figures represent the total billed cost, not the patient’s final responsibility.
Patients who are uninsured or who have high-deductible plans that have not been met are the ones most likely to be exposed to these full gross charges. Obtaining an estimate based on the specific Current Procedural Terminology (CPT) codes used is the most accurate way to gauge the expected charge.
Key Factors Driving Price Variation
The setting where the test is performed is the largest non-insurance factor contributing to price disparity. Hospital outpatient departments consistently charge the highest prices, reflecting a higher institutional overhead and a different fee schedule than independent facilities. In contrast, tests performed in a standalone cardiology clinic or an independent imaging center are typically priced significantly lower.
Geographic location plays a significant role in determining the final cost, with higher prices generally found in major metropolitan areas and regions with a higher cost of living. This variation is due to differences in labor costs for specialized technicians, real estate prices, and regional market forces.
The specific method used to stress the heart also influences the overall expense. While an exercise-based test is common, patients unable to exercise require a pharmacological stress test using a medication like Regadenoson (Lexiscan) or Dobutamine. Chemical stress tests are generally more expensive than exercise tests, as they involve the additional cost of the pharmaceutical agent. The type of radioactive tracer used, such as Technetium-99m or Thallium-201, can also introduce minor cost differences.
Navigating Insurance Coverage and Patient Responsibility
The patient’s final out-of-pocket expense is determined by their specific health insurance plan. Once the negotiated rate between the insurer and the provider is applied, the patient is responsible for their deductible, co-insurance, and co-pay amounts. Patients with commercial insurance often see out-of-pocket costs ranging from a few hundred dollars up to \$2,000, depending on their plan’s structure.
The network status of the testing facility is a paramount consideration, as receiving the procedure from an out-of-network provider can lead to substantially higher costs and potential balance billing. With balance billing, the provider charges the patient the difference between their billed amount and the amount the insurance company pays. Medicare Part B, for example, typically covers 80% of the cost after the annual deductible is met, leaving the patient responsible for the 20% co-insurance.
Many commercial insurance plans require a prior authorization before a nuclear stress test is performed. Failure to obtain this authorization can result in the insurance company denying the claim entirely, leaving the patient liable for the full cost. Patients should contact their insurer directly to confirm coverage details, in-network status, and authorization requirements before scheduling the procedure.
